Wrong Date for uploaded Images with iOS Filesapp and Cryptomator

Open micha-09 opened this issue 3 years ago • 4 comments

Please agree to the following

Summary

An uploaded Image has no creation date and wrong change date

System Setup

  • iOS: 15.5
  • Cryptomator: 2.3.0 (967)

Cloud Type

WebDAV

Steps to Reproduce

  1. In iOS photos, select picture and save in files
  2. Select folder in cryptomator vault and save file

Expected Behavior

The picture is encrypted and uploaded in the webdav target. The creation and changed date of picture is the same as in the original picture on the iPhone.

Actual Behavior

The picture has no creation date and the changed date ist set to save time in vault. For example the first picture shows the infos for the file on a local path in the files app on the iPhone, the second picture shows the infos for the same file in Cryptomator vault in the files app. On the first picture are correct dates set after save in files app.

First picture: IMG_0345

Second picture: IMG_0344

Reproducibility

Always
